Interpreted Prediction
If the Bank of Japan raises interest rates, Foreign Institutional Investors (FIs) who have borrowed in Yen and invested in the Indian market may repay loans, leading to increased stock selling.
AI Evaluation Notes
The Bank of Japan (BOJ) raised interest rates in March 2024, which may have led to some repatriation of Yen from foreign investments, including the Indian market. While it's difficult to definitively quantify the impact solely from this event, it's plausible that some stock selling occurred, aligning with the prediction.
